On Jul 31, 4:51pm, Christopher.C.Amley-1 wrote: > My car, like many 4-cylinder, TRs tends to run hot and I was wondering > whether the hole reduces the effectiveness of the radiator. Yes, somewhat. > It looks as tho the tubes are just blocked off at the hole. Correct. > (Is there a passage for coolant around the hole?) Nope. > Anyway, I was wondering whether fitting a new radiator core, sans > crank hole, would result in better cooling. Yes it will, but not a whole lot, maybe 15-20% or so. > Has anyone done this? I've done it, but I'm certainly not the only one. cheers, John Lye rjl6n@uva.pcmail.Virginia.EDU |
